True crime stories often involve complex investigations. There are clues to be followed, witnesses to be interviewed, and evidence to be analyzed. All these elements combined make it like a real - life mystery that draws people in. For example, in the Jack the Ripper case, the police had to sift through a lot of false leads and misinformation while trying to catch the killer. It was a complex web of mystery that has intrigued people for over a century. These stories also make us feel a sense of safety when the criminals are finally caught. They give us hope that justice can prevail even in the darkest of situations.

They offer a peek into the human psyche. When we hear about true crime stories, we get to see the dark side of human nature. How can someone be capable of such heinous crimes? Take the Manson Family murders. Charles Manson was able to manipulate his followers into committing brutal murders. Understanding his motives and the psychology of his followers is both fascinating and disturbing.
